Laurel Hill East, founded in 1836, is located in Philadelphia and is a 78-acre National Historic Landmark. Laurel Hill West, 187-acres located in Bala Cynwyd, was founded in 1869 and is the location of the Laurel Hill Funeral Home. Both cemeteries are 501(c)(13) organizations and active burial sites, an accredited arboretum, exceptional educational and community resources, and unique recreational spaces. The Friends of Laurel Hill is a 501(c)(3) non-profit organization dedicated to preserving, protecting and promoting the visual and historic character of both cemeteries through progressive interpretation, education and fundraising.
Laurel Hill, two of America’s most historic cemeteries and funeral home, has an exciting opportunity for an experienced Director of Development.
Reporting to the President & CEO, the Director of Development is responsible for developing, implementing, and monitoring Laurel Hill’s annual fundraising plan. This includes identifying and analyzing constituencies, cultivating and stewarding prospective and existing donors; ascertaining sponsorship and naming opportunities; conducting annual fund and membership drives, seeking and managing grant funding, overseeing the development and execution of revenue producing public programs and fundraising events, and bolstering relationships with community stakeholders. The Director of Development is a member of Laurel Hill’s executive team and supervises a team of four full-time employees and additional part-time/seasonal/volunteer workers whose efforts focus on the expansion and long-term growth of the Friends of Laurel Hill.
